Type
ORACLE
Validation date
2024-07-12 00:36: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01317,
    "usd": 0.01432
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00019B0F90FB452C4B32B0901E14CCF2BF70F8F711ADF9E3D8E0D80570365663CC69

Previous signature

2D2BDA85304428E2C05C2E9866ED7EC979ED7BC4C9BB7E4877658ABF11F01F82AA41A308F7D84866DF1D67F03BE9CD55F810225EBB6134E7F5BA598938FB0001

Origin signature

3045022058A7B2A6E1563ADB95ABF4C43097A0AE5EB6147CF6D34182D549EE6A586159A0022100E6AB50C98228BDBDAF2F55D674BFFB5CCFE4AB6C2A7BBD461D9536CDF592A5B8

Proof of work

010104BB7216545F28C83467606EDA88968E19C436410AB446D1BC88FEBDE3506275F9B0B931CAAE420B96B2A158B7112F13795C878CCC346C76E04A96C59CCFC6FC39

Proof of integrity

00BA1E73F9E0CDA4BBE4B52E72A99D86AC8453D4E78CCE58269081E3F86DCFAC90

Coordinator signature

4F28EF0908283D1A3CC1824CB16C5EF431D71663A06752FD8DD8CD593095EF88ACCCD4E3CEB077846EAA605B72ADDF2440BE2F7D9387036DEEC5CD10A533DF0C

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

74CE2AE1818343535E6EDDD152C1BCEE3374786502CF965BF506D834F6B72A684BA54D08CE6074BAD1907AC94CABA7055A1CF35A182986BACEFA83D829DAC90D

Validator #2 public key

00011B58ED42235461734EAF253BD97A80B92899ABCC3BE680D44B6825DD2A88A947

Validator #2 signature

D9E5E7D37AE817C9FD29DC84421FC95B2C59C952D9F9760E4D4D12DC430B695A67958C6376945BA8C91D00443E5E8B3C15598FF50D19F043F70F5DBB7E565906